6 6 Apportionment of legislature seats based on populations of districts

7 7 Method of Greatest Remainder – Favoring districts with larger population Order the remainder q i   q i , and allocate, one each, to the districts having the largest fractional remainders. Integer programming problem.

8 8 Alabama paradox – Loss of House Monotone Property Increase in the total number of seats may force a state to lose seats −In 1880, Alabama would get 8 seats from total of 299, but only 7 from total of 300. It changes priority order of assigning surplus seats. Alabama had an exact quota of 7.646 at 299 seats and 7.671 at 300 seats. Texas and Illinois increased their quotas from 9.040 and 18.640 to 9.682 and 18.702, respectively.

9 9 Population paradox State X could lose seats to state Y even though population of X had grown faster than population of Y. New States Paradox Adding new state, and increasing number of seats, can cause another state to lose seats. −In1907, Oklahoma added as new sate with 5 new seats to House (386 to 391). Maine’s apportionment went up (3 to 4) while New York’s went down (38 to 37).

10 10 Two-sided matching schemes University admission schemes −Individual student has preference list of programs −Each program has its own priority choices of students Marriage Social Choice Theory Social choice theory studies voting rules for how individual preferences are aggregated to form collective preference.

11 11 Impossibility Theorem A characteristic method proceeds from formulating some set of apparently reasonable axioms of social choice as requirements for a social welfare function (constitution) to capture different aspects of the aggregation problem. Logical incompatibility of different axioms No voting system can convert the ranked preferences of individuals into a commodity-wide ranking while also meeting a certain set of reasonable criteria with 3 or more discrete options to choose from.

12 12 Measurement of political power United Nations Security Council Big “five” permanent members, each has veto power. Ten “small” countries whose membership rotates. What is the relative strength (political power) of the “big” and “small” nations?

13 13 United States federal system 537 voters in the system: 435 Representatives, 100 Senators, the Vice President and the President. The President has veto power that can be overridden by a two-thirds vote of both the House and the Senate. The Vice President plays the role of tie breaker in the Senate
